TICKET-982: Hey — welcome aboard. The Tollgate payments integration suite keeps flaking on the signature check step, not the payments logic itself. Turns out the test harness regenerates fixtures but signs them with a stale key from the old CI image, so verification fails maybe 1 in 5 runs. Pin the harness to the current key instead of whatever the image ships. For reference, here's the key it should use.

signing key of yajog-kafof = bky19_orbYRY3Abj3KpZesMie

LEADERSHIP REVIEW BRIEFING — Loyalty Programme Overhaul

For the incoming director. Current programme: points-based, 1.1M members, redemption rate falling three quarters straight. Proposal: replace with tiered membership under the working name Emberline, paid top tier included. Costs front-loaded; breakeven modelled at month 19. Ops impact concentrated in the Farrowgate contact centre. Decision required at the review: approve full build or extend the Selcourt trial. The commercial rationale, restricted to attendees, appears in the note below.

board note of kageg-bahof: The renewal with Holwynax Holdings closes at $2 million a year, 5 percent below the last contract. Project Ulaath slips by two quarters because of the supplier delay.

# Env file — Cartwheel dispatch, driver-assignment heuristic
# Scope: staging only. Do not promote to prod.
# The heuristic weights (proximity, shift balance, refusal rate) are tuned
# for the Velmont pilot region and will misbehave elsewhere.
# Review notes: heuristic service runs unprivileged; it reads weights
# read-only from the tuning store and writes nothing back.
# Only one sensitive value exists in this file: the tuning-store access
# credential, consumed at boot and never logged.
# That credential is set on the following line.

secret setting of faduf-bahop: LEDGER_TOKEN8=c3b363be

## Authentication

So you're writing a plugin for Perchlight, the watchdog that keeps our Brambleton kiosk fleet from wedging itself overnight. Plugins talk to the watchdog's local control API, and yes, even local calls need a key — we learned that the hard way after a rogue demo plugin rebooted a whole lobby of kiosks. Grab a plugin-scoped key from the Perchlight dev portal, stash it in your plugin manifest, and never commit it. For local testing against the sandbox watchdog, use the key below.

service key, fawip-bajef: kto11_Qt5wZK9vdNC